Fatal Error, LowLevelFatalError, and No Report Crashes
At this point, this game is unplayable for me, or at least, not worth my time. I’ve had issues with “Fatal Errors” since I first download the game back in January. I resolved them for a few days after figuring out I had a bad driver install and fixing it. It has gotten out of control since the 14.8 patch, and NVIDIA’s driver release on 3/5/24.

**I will comment on this thread with a dxdiag file, after replicating these issues, this afternoon. I am at work and on mobile at this time.

**HLL is installed on my 512gb NVME M.2. It is the only application on there aside from my OS, and there is ~230gb of open storage remaining.

Here is what is happening:
1. I’ll load the game up, select my server, and attempt to load in. I’ll get to the loading screen where it shows what map is in rotation, with the HLL logo/loading indicator in the bottom right hand corner. It will cycle the loading animation once or twice, stop, and crash me to my desktop. Sometimes I get an error message saying “LowLevelFatalError [File:Unknown] [Line 139] - Shader compilation errors are Fatal”, other times not. It sometimes takes 10-15 minutes of repeatedly trying to join, regardless of what server, to get into a game. Luckily I have purchased/earned VIP in a few servers, so I don’t have to spend 30+ mins in queue each time trying to load in.
2. When I do get in, I’ll get 30-45 mins of gameplay before crashing with a “Fatal Error!” message. I’ll have to repeat the process in paragraph 1 to get back in.
3. When I do get back in, I’m often met with an account recognition bug. The game will show me as “notacop_1”, Lvl 1, with no progression, not “notacop”, Lvl 70ish, with almost 250 hours of progression. I have to restart the game in order to clear this bug, repeating the process in paragraph 1.
- Regardless, I lose all experience gained up until the first crash. I’ve been tanking recently and my squad and I have been dropping 75+ kill games regularly. If I crash in the last 5 mins, for example, I will no longer have a combat score, offensive/defensive score, or support score from my reps. My “Personal Stats” page will still show my kill count, KDR, etc…, but I gain no XP from the 85 mins I played. Hence why I say, not worth my time anymore.
- After these crashes, my config file will also be corrupted/overwritten. This means all cosmetic/class choices will be returned to default, as well as any settings (mostly VOIP sliders) returned to their defaults as well. The “config.ini” file is not set to read-only either.
4. Say I do make it through a match, I will almost always crash out on the loading screen for the next match, beginning the process anew at paragraph 1.

Here is what I have done so far, in the order I did them:
1. Ran dxdiag and returned APPCRASH for “HLL_BugReportUploader.exe” and “HLL-Win64-Shipping.exe” returning “ntdll.dll” and “nvgpucomp64.dll” as faulting modules, respectively.

I can see from your DxDiag that you have both an onboard Intel graphics card as well as the dedicated NVIDIA card - can you please make sure that you are attempting to run the game through your NVIDIA and not your Intel card? To do this:
  1. Type Settings in Windows Search and press Enter
  2. Click on System
  3. Under the Display tab, scroll down to the end and click on Graphics Settings
  4. Select Desktop App and click on Browse
  5. Find the game's location, select the .exe file and click on Add
  6. Click on Options, select High performance and Save
Then please retest the game and see if the issue persists.

If so, Can you please follow the steps in the link to perform a clean boot?[team17.helpshift.com]
A clean boot is being used to start your Windows device using a minimal set of drivers and startup programs.

Once this is done please launch the game to see if the issue still continues.

If the crash no longer happens when your start up programs are disabled, we would recommend enabling these programs again one-by-one to see if there is a specific program that is causing conflict. To re-enable your start-up programs:
  1. Follow the steps above again but enable all of your programs and services.
  2. Then click Apply and restart your computer.

To take a screenshot, please make sure, that you have Steam Overlay enabled in your game
  1. Go to Steam -> Settings.
  2. Click the In-Game tab.
  3. Check "Enable Steam Overlay while in-game"
  4. Go to Library.
  5. Right-click on the game title and select Properties.
  6. Under the General tab also make sure "Enable Steam Overlay while in-game" is checked.
In the game, press F12 to take a screenshot. Then press Shift+Tab to bring up the Steam overlay, and Upload your screenshot, make it public. Then simply include the URL of your screenshot on the forum (it should look something like "http...sharedfiles/filedetails/?id=...")

We would like to request that you also please send us your DxDiag information via the steps below: 
  1. Hold down the Windows Key and press R 
  2. The Run dialog should appear. Type dxdiag in the available text field. 
  3. Click OK 
  4. Click Save All Information 
  5. Set the Save as type to Text File (*.txt) 
  6. Save the file DxDiag.txt to your Desktop so it is easy to find. 
  7. Open the .txt file, copy all the contents > Paste all the contents to a free text hosting service such as https://justpaste.it/ or http://pastebin.com/
  8. Copy the link to your post and paste in your reply
